How hard is it to find a job in EMS if you have little or no experience driving?
Currently I just have a learner's permit, and hopefully by the time I finish my EMT-B course I'll have a license. But will being a new driver hold me back in EMS? Will it keep me from getting hired anywhere?

I hope not, because I really want to do this and continue on with my education until I'm a paramedic.
 
Most places aren't going to care as long as you have your license and if your state requires an extension you will need that as well. Oh and keep your driving record clean.

What you need to look into is if you state has an EVOC/AVOC requirement... and see what those requirements are.
 
Some services require you to be 21 for insurance purposes, some don't. Call the ones you are interested in and ask them.
 
You will probably still need EVOC to drive the ambulance though. Regardless of experience. And really, I've been driving for over a decade and EVOC still taught me a thing or two about driving. So take it anyway.
